This slow-growing shrub is a seasonal chameleon, offering fragrant, unique bottle-brush blooms in spring and a brilliant, multi-colored display in autumn. Its disease-resistant nature and compact, rounded habit make it a reliable, low-maintenance choice for adding texture and color to the landscape.

Performance breakdown
Seasonal Visual Impact
Exceptional multi-season display with vibrant spring blooms and fiery autumn foliage.
Maintenance Ease
Slow growth habit minimizes the need for frequent pruning or shaping.
Pest Resilience
Naturally deer-resistant foliage keeps garden protection efforts to an absolute minimum.
Landscape Versatility
Compact size fits perfectly in containers, borders, or smaller garden beds.
Pollinator Appeal
Fragrant spring flowers provide a reliable early-season nectar source for bees.
Hardiness Reliability
Robust performance across USDA zones 5 through 9 ensures consistent survival.
